Navigating Crypto Markets
Crypto markets are the digital exchanges where cryptocurrencies are traded for other assets like fiat currencies, commodities, or other cryptocurrencies. Crypto markets are highly volatile and unpredictable, making them risky for investors. To navigate these markets successfully, it is important to understand the different dynamics that affect crypto prices.
The first factor to consider is supply and demand. As with any asset, the demand for a particular cryptocurrency will drive its price. When demand is low, prices tend to decrease, while high demand will result in increases. Supply is also a major factor, as the total number of coins is always fixed. This means that if demand is high, but the supply is low, the price of the cryptocurrency will rise dramatically.
Another important factor in crypto markets is regulation. Governments around the world are starting to implement regulations on cryptocurrencies, which can significantly affect prices. Investors should keep an eye on any news or changes in regulations to determine if buying or selling is a good idea.
What to Expect
Crypto markets are highly unpredictable, so investors should be cautious when making investments. It is important to understand the different dynamics that affect crypto prices and to stay up to date on any changes in regulations.
Investors should also be aware of market manipulation, which can significantly affect prices. Market manipulation can occur when large investors buy large amounts of a particular cryptocurrency in order to artificially drive up prices. This can be a lucrative strategy, but it is important to be aware of it.
Finally, investors should always be mindful of their own risk tolerance. Crypto markets can offer high returns, but they can also be risky. It is important to understand the risks involved and be patient when investing. This will help ensure that investments are made with caution and that any losses are minimized.
